The Nature Museum in Olsztyn is the youngest branch of the Museum of Warmia and Mazury. It was established on 1 January 2000, but already before that, since 1956, there was a Department of Nature of the Museum of Warmia and Mazury, and the collection of natural resources began in 1951. The collection started with the post-German collections: 38 animal specimens - mostly damaged, 12 boxes with 284 geological exhibits and a well-preserved herbarium of Hans Steffen, consisting of about 460 sheets. In the course of the following years the collection grew rapidly.
